The first group task was to gather general welfare statistics for Lima and Bluffton.  This group also included welfare statistics for all of Allen County, in order to provide a reference point to compare and contrast other data.  The second group task was to focus on WIC. They went into local grocery stores and spoke with store managers. They were able to find out exactly what foods and brands are available through the WIC program, how the store managers and the government work together, who the WIC program helps and how the program operates.  The task of the third group was to focus on free and reduce lunches. This group not only provided data on who is eligible for free and reduced lunches, but also explained how the system could be changed in the future. Finally, the third groups explained what consisted of a healthy lunch and how each school was held accountable. The last group examined unemployment and provided general statistics.  They also explained how unemployment affects the community, the employer and the individual.

There were common themes throughout the PowerPoints.  One of the most common themes was how people are taking advantage of the various programs welfare offers.  This led our class to have a debate over what do you do when a few people are taking advantage of a system in which many people benefit from? Do you simply allow it to continue, so the programs are available for the people who really need it? Do you eliminate the program, because it is our tax money that pays for these programs?  Or is there a compromise which appeases everyone? These are not easy questions to answer.
